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Facilities and Accessibility at Manorbier Station

For those considering a trip via Manorbier, note that the station lacks a ticket office and ticket machines, which makes advance online booking essential. Although devoid of a physical ticket presence, an induction loop is available for those with hearing impairments, ensuring a smooth auditory experience for announcements. While there are no waiting rooms, canopies, or lounges to relax in, seating is available for weary travelers needing a moment to themselves. Despite the lack of a fully accessible infrastructure, the station is classified as Category A, offering step-free access throughout, from a narrow road without a sidewalk directly to the platform.

Facilities and Amenities at Yeovil Junction

Yeovil Junction is well-equipped to help you kick off your journey with ease. The station operates a ticket office open from 06:00 to 19:20 on weekdays and Saturdays, and from 08:55 to 18:25 on Sundays. For added convenience, ticket machines are accessible and include options for Disabled Persons Railcard discounts, making it easier to plan ahead and collect tickets purchased online.

There are several customer service amenities available. While the station lacks luggage storage services, it does have CCTV and customer help points to ensure safety and timely assistance. Furthermore, public Wi-Fi is accessible, and a helpful refreshment café is also available if you wish to grab a coffee before your journey.

Travel Connections: Seamless Onward Travel

Yeovil Junction connects you to various transport links. If a rail replacement service is needed, it's conveniently located at the station car park off Newton Road. For more detailed bus connections, travelers can find printable journey plans here, ensuring you don't miss out on local explorations.

Though there are no cycle hire facilities, bike storage is available with 16 spaces monitored by CCTV. For those driving to the station, parking options abound with 197 spaces, including six accessible spots, all available through RingGo's easy-to-use service.
